The video tutorial explains how to calculate the area of an equilateral triangle as a function of its side length, s. It begins by introducing the concept of an equilateral triangle and the goal of finding its area. The triangle is split into two 30-60-90 triangles by dropping an altitude, which bisects the top angle and the base. The properties of 30-60-90 triangles are used to determine the altitude, which is crucial for calculating the area. The area is then calculated using the formula 1/2 times the base times the height, resulting in a general formula for the area of an equilateral triangle.
